Sadaksari-Lokesvara Mandala
https://clevelandart.org/art/1965.336
A quintet of Buddhist divinities are seated on lotus thrones supported by scrolling floral forms. They are carved in relief on a wooden block and arranged diagrammatically. This configuration establishes the icon to be a mandala.
